CartagenaThe mud is only the first half of this one. After the bath, the rinse happens in the ciénaga next to the volcano, and then the vehicle carries on to a beach club, where lunch is included along with the pool, the common areas and the beach for the rest of the afternoon. Active mud volcanoes open to visitors are rare, which is most of why El Totumo is on every list of things to do out of Cartagena. The mud is thick with natural minerals and thick enough to float in, which is the part people are unprepared for. It photographs well, if that matters to you, and the volcano itself is a short activity, easy to fit around other plans, though the version with lunch takes up more of the day. The services at the volcano are run by the local communities, and dealing with them directly is part of what you are paying for. Pick-up starts at 8:00 from the Clock Tower, the main gate into the walled city, and works north through the hotel zones. Six collection points cover Getsemaní and downtown, Marbella and Torices, Manzanillo, Sky Quarter Sea and two in La Boquilla. Transport is by bus or air-conditioned van, and the day ends back at the hotels.
